If you're seeking a Bachelor's Degree in other astronomy and astrophysics, you will have fewer peers than average since the major degree program is the #797 one in the country in terms of popularity.This may make is a little harder to find a school that is a good fit for you.

There was only one school in the Middle Atlantic Region to review for the 2022 Best Other Astronomy & Astrophysics Bachelor's Degree Schools in the Middle Atlantic Region ranking. It's difficult to beat George Washington University if you want to pursue a bachelor's degree in other astronomy and astrophysics. Located in the city of Washington, GWU is a private not-for-profit university with a fairly large student population.More information about a bachelor’s in other astronomy and astrophysics from George Washington University
